Determine which kind of swap is right for you. The most common choice is the swapping of primary residences, in which case both parties are vacationing in each others' houses at precisely the same time. If you own more than one dwelling, you can participate in swaps that are coincident so you could travel at another time than the man with whom you are swapping. With this sort of swap, you may be able to exchange vacation rentals and timeshares. Another type of nonsimultaneous exchange could entail inviting a man to stay in your house while you are there, and vice versa.
A Short Term Apartment Rentals in Newport NSW arrangement should contain the address of the property being rented, the dates and times that the renter will have access to the property, age, and maximum occupancy rules, payment policies, check out procedures, cancellation policies and the rules connected with the property, such as rules affecting pets, smoking, and pool or utility use. If the property can be found in a location where storms or hurricanes may occur, a clause may be added if there is a mandatory evacuation that allows for refunds or cancellations.

The contract should also include a cancellation policy which will deter a renter from backing out of the trade. The contract should contain a good faith clause that will release the renter from the contract if a disaster occurs before the lease and renders the property uninhabitable if the property is in an area prone to natural disasters such as hurricanes, floods or earthquakes.
Have all terms in writing for the vacation home rental. The contract must say the place of the property, dates of rent payment schedule, entire rental price and leasing. Any individual policies for example policies relating to pets, smoking, and occupancy limits also must be in the contract. Include a damages clause, which sets deposit rules and monetary repercussions affecting any damages done to the property.
